无忧启动论坛

 找回密码
 注册
搜索
系统gho:最纯净好用系统下载站投放广告、加入VIP会员,请联系 微信:wuyouceo
楼主: netwinxp
打印 上一主题 下一主题

[待测]常见磁盘控制器驱动[2010-04-08]

[复制链接]
691#
发表于 2010-4-12 10:48:13 | 只看该作者

回复 #703 netwinxp 的帖子

我想应该是不行的,感谢指导!
[HiveInfs.Fresh]放到PE中并不实用,我还是将这些东西放到[HardwareIdsDatabase]
回复

使用道具 举报

692#
发表于 2010-4-12 11:36:16 | 只看该作者
0408

有的出现篮屏.不一定是新驱动造成.

新驱动不妥.可造成的后果.主要是.不识硬盘或板卡.

篮屏的主要原因.应该是PE缺支持文件或文件版本不合适.
回复

使用道具 举报

693#
发表于 2010-4-12 13:18:26 | 只看该作者
干脆netwinxp 给列一下pc、笔记本、常见的阵列卡的算了。这些一般维护就够用了。
回复

使用道具 举报

694#
 楼主| 发表于 2010-4-12 13:42:26 | 只看该作者
这个不好界定,工作站算不算常用,入门服务器呢?真的最常用的也就intel、amd(ati)、nv(ali)、sis、via,再加上si3112/3112r、mv61xx/614x、hpt371/374/3xx、PDC ultra(Fasttrak)、ITE、JMB,也就是我这个帖子单独列出来的那些。我没列出来的基本上很少会出现在个人级的PC机上。简单地说就是对我原来的那些方案所包含的hwid进行sif和sys文件更新即可(其中intel、nv、ati sb6xx的hwid要稍微调整一下)。

[ 本帖最后由 netwinxp 于 2010-4-12 13:49 编辑 ]
回复

使用道具 举报

695#
发表于 2010-4-12 14:20:06 | 只看该作者
驱动包外置可以对驱动集分类,将认为命中率高(例如80%以上)的作为常用驱动包默认加载,其它作为(第二、第三...)备用驱动包,可选加载或临时输入指定。互相冲突的分别打包并存。
驱动包可有多种结构。增加驱动简单。少用的驱动包还可以考虑剪裁掉。

0pe的多外置驱动包机制比较灵活。这里集成了N版方案,请测试:http://bbs.wuyou.net/forum.php?m ... ;page=58#pid1930509
回复

使用道具 举报

696#
发表于 2010-4-12 14:28:38 | 只看该作者
原帖由 <i>pseudo</i> 于 2010-4-12 14:20 发表 <a href="http://bbs.wuyou.net/redirect.php?goto=findpost&pid=1930811&ptid=122156" target="_blank"><img src="http://bbs.wuyou.net/images/common/back.gif" border="0" onload="if(this.width>screen.width*0.7) {this.resized=true; this.width=screen.width*0.7; this.alt='Click here to open new window\nCTRL+Mouse wheel to zoom in/out';}" onmouseover="if(this.width>screen.width*0.7) {this.resized=true; this.width=screen.width*0.7; this.style.cursor='hand'; this.alt='Click here to open new window\nCTRL+Mouse wheel to zoom in/out';}" onclick="if(!this.resized) {return true;} else {window.open(this.src);}" onmousewheel="return imgzoom(this);" alt="" /></a><br />
驱动包外置可以对驱动集分类,将认为命中率高(例如80%以上)的作为常用驱动包默认加载,其它作为(第二、第三...)备用驱动包,可选加载或临时输入指定。互相冲突的分别打包并存。<br />
驱动包可有多种结构。增加驱 ...
<br />


驱动放到OP里去吗?  我是小菜,只是了解下.也没有好的意见惭愧啊!
回复

使用道具 举报

697#
发表于 2010-4-12 14:30:16 | 只看该作者
支持!加油!问题总会解决.
回复

使用道具 举报

698#
发表于 2010-4-12 14:31:18 | 只看该作者

raidsrc="Intel GDT Series RAID Controllers"
INIC162X="INITIO INIC162x S-ATA RAID Controller"


请问n版,

上面2个是用在服务器上的,还是pc上的,是主板内置的,还是以额外的板卡存在的
回复

使用道具 举报

699#
 楼主| 发表于 2010-4-12 14:41:04 | 只看该作者
前者一般是服务器主板上集成,后者通常是板卡(比如Sunix的SATA-1111卡、UPTECH 的SR201和SC200),这两种基本不出现在普通PC机上。

[ 本帖最后由 netwinxp 于 2010-4-12 14:42 编辑 ]
回复

使用道具 举报

700#
发表于 2010-4-12 15:00:01 | 只看该作者
原帖由 netwinxp 于 2010-4-12 14:41 发表
前者一般是服务器主板上集成,后者通常是板卡(比如Sunix的SATA-1111卡、UPTECH 的SR201和SC200),这两种基本不出现在普通PC机上。


谢谢。

另外,还有个问题请教一下

HPT3xx 371 374这几个,pc主板集成的应该也不算常见吧

还有Promise是不是全系列基本上都是扩展卡,很少pc主板集成的?
回复

使用道具 举报

701#
发表于 2010-4-12 16:07:17 | 只看该作者
我一直有点混淆。。。到现在还没搞清楚

常见磁盘控制器驱动 和srs什么关系还是一样?-_-!!

芯片组驱动,磁盘驱动,阵列驱动?
回复

使用道具 举报

702#
发表于 2010-4-12 16:40:00 | 只看该作者
原帖由 yjd 于 2010-4-12 16:07 发表
我一直有点混淆。。。到现在还没搞清楚
常见磁盘控制器驱动 和srs什么关系还是一样?-_-!!
芯片组驱动,磁盘驱动,阵列驱动?

现在之所以坛里叫SRS,很大程度上是因为在0PE里这么叫,后来大家跟着叫开了,看来也比较简洁。

其实我也不懂,分不清什么磁盘驱动、磁盘控制器驱动、SATA、RAID、SCSI、AHCI的,所以叫SRS最保险,因为SRS可解释为SATA/RAID/SCSI。
另外有时我也叫SATA/RAID,你看安装windows时与F6相关的提示就是这样的。

老外maanu曾告诉我,国外一般不叫SRS。
回复

使用道具 举报

703#
发表于 2010-4-12 16:52:30 | 只看该作者
fttxr52p="Fasttrak TX2200/2300 SATA RAID5"
fttxr5_0="Fasttrak TX4200/43xx/579/779 SATA2 RAID5"
stex="Supertrak EX/TX Series SATA/SAS RAID"

请问n版,最开始的那个包里面的三个dll文件,是不是这3个都要用到的
回复

使用道具 举报

704#
 楼主| 发表于 2010-4-12 17:19:47 | 只看该作者

回复 #716 NicTense 的帖子

这三个都不用,它们分别用于ULSATA(FASTTX2K)、ULSATA2,是用来识别是SATA还是SATA RAID,没有这文件可能会认不到阵列。HPT36x、37x,PDC26x在P3/K7,PDC27x在P4级主板有集成。
其实硬盘控制器(或许应该叫存储控制器)叫成SRS不是很合理,即使扩展成Storage(SATA)&RAID&SCSI(SAS)也不是很合理。因为现在网络存储也发展起来了,比如NAS、SAN、IP SAN(含iSCSI和FC over IP等)。其实存储控制器主要包含两大类:通道卡、功能卡(RAID卡只是其中一种)。前者通常被称为HBA,提供连接存储设备的通道和端口,可以增加主板所能驳接的最大存储设备数目;而后者主要用来提供某些功能给存储设备,比如阵列卡就是用来把若干硬盘组成阵列,它通常会同时自带通道,但也有不提供通道的,比如0通道阵列卡,这时候只能使用主板自带的通道或者其他通道卡带的,简单地说0通道阵列卡本身并没有接硬盘的接口。

[ 本帖最后由 netwinxp 于 2010-4-12 17:39 编辑 ]
回复

使用道具 举报

705#
发表于 2010-4-12 18:06:15 | 只看该作者
原帖由 pseudo 于 2010-4-12 16:40 发表

现在之所以坛里叫SRS,很大程度上是因为在0PE里这么叫,后来大家跟着叫开了,看来也比较简洁。

其实我也不懂,分不清什么磁盘驱动、磁盘控制器驱动、SATA、RAID、SCSI、AHCI的,所以叫SRS最保险,因为SRS可 ...



谢谢pseudo大,明白了不少。

再者论坛好多人都发f6.img 文件都不知道哪个才是最新最全了。比如这里的楼主经常更新这个好像小马也整合了个-_-!!。。

p大你的srs.zip是不是经常更新?如果是那以后我U盘里就同步你那个就好了^_^
回复

使用道具 举报

706#
发表于 2010-4-12 20:06:26 | 只看该作者
原帖由 yjd 于 2010-4-12 18:06 发表
谢谢pseudo大,明白了不少。
再者论坛好多人都发f6.img 文件都不知道哪个才是最新最全了。比如这里的楼主经常更新这个好像小马也整合了个-_-!!。。
p大你的srs.zip是不是经常更新?如果是那以后我U ...

img扩展名的驱动包大致有两种。

一种是单一厂商提供的驱动软盘内容的映像,可能起名为intel.img,amd.img等。这是简单、原始的驱动包。
由于这种驱动包内容基本上直接来自厂商,可能最新,但一般只包含单一厂商的、针对部分型号机器的驱动版本。

另一种是前年netwinxp版主提供的“目前常见南桥AHCI&RAID驱动F6软盘映像”。
在intel、NV、sis、amd等等厂家单一驱动软盘(img映像)基础上,合成了一个包含多个厂家、多种型号驱动的驱动软盘(img映像)。
这种最全,但制作费力,印象中几乎只有N版主提供过。0PE 目前版本的A.ZIP文件内容主要来源于此(作了点扩充)。

当img包含多种驱动时,一般需要有dos程序来自动确定该用哪个,这个技术最早在0pe/micrope中实现。

img扩展名的驱动包后来发展为zip扩展名的驱动包。后者有更多灵活的格式。参见:F6模块zip格式驱动包

现在许多人搞多pe合盘,但少有人搞多驱动包合盘,呵呵。

如果采用类似0PE的灵活机制,可以包罗一大堆来自各PE的驱动包,尽管有重复冗余,但理论上可以比普通PE全。

0PEv1.0.9里,在根目录下专门弄个SRS目录,等着收罗大家的成果。现在已经收罗了一些驱动包,包括最新的intel 8.9、9.6版驱动等。
这些驱动效果有待考验,但号称:哪个PE1.X能找到硬盘,0PE用其驱动包(很容易提取)一般也能。如果不能那是有BUG:)

收集有N版主截止4.11最新驱动的0PE小维护版在#708楼。
回复

使用道具 举报

707#
发表于 2010-4-12 21:20:31 | 只看该作者
原帖由 pseudo 于 2010-4-12 20:06 发表

img扩展名的驱动包大致有两种。

一种是单一厂商提供的驱动软盘内容的映像,可能起名为intel.img,amd.img等。这是简单、原始的驱动包。
由于这种驱动包内容基本上直接来自厂商,可能最新,但一般只包含单 ...


感谢p大这么详细的回复。辛苦了

总算明白了。
回复

使用道具 举报

708#
发表于 2010-4-13 08:18:12 | 只看该作者
继续等待完美方案。或者把有问题的驱动暂时辟开。
回复

使用道具 举报

709#
 楼主| 发表于 2010-4-13 09:07:35 | 只看该作者
新增Agilent HHBA-510x/512x/522x FC驱动,如果原来有用2K3 AFCNT的,可以不用添加,本驱动是for 2000的。(仍在61页打补丁)
BTW:目前有问题的驱动有——Emulex、MV91xx,建议先避过。
回复

使用道具 举报

710#
发表于 2010-4-13 10:26:44 | 只看该作者
ahci8086  有两个版本,其中一个是ati的

不知道有什么区别?

另外,ahci8086 能驱动 4391 的个别型号
回复

使用道具 举报

711#
 楼主| 发表于 2010-4-13 10:51:40 | 只看该作者

回复 #723 dvd008 的帖子

估计AMD想把SB6xx和SB7xx/8xx整合成一个,其实不用管它,SB6xx的驱动已经很久没更新了。
回复

使用道具 举报

712#
发表于 2010-4-13 23:11:19 | 只看该作者
看了十几页,看不懂,自己太菜了;不知哪位大侠能整理出一个实用于03的驱动包呢?
回复

使用道具 举报

713#
发表于 2010-4-14 20:05:55 | 只看该作者
netwinxp 能不能稍微抽点时间看看这个驱动包,修正一下,用于nlite集成的SATA驱动,尤其intel方面的,其它的我不知道,他这个包intel用的是
5.5.2.1003
6.2.1.1002
8.9.4.1004

http://u.115.com/file/f1f2abeac9
回复

使用道具 举报

714#
 楼主| 发表于 2010-4-14 20:25:10 | 只看该作者
8.9.4.1004时间稍微早了点,对部分i3、i5、i7兼容不是很佳。imsm8.9.6是今年出的,imsm8.9.4.1004去年底出的,5系列今年才大量上市,所以imsm以8.9.6稳妥,从理论上irst9.6无疑相当引人注目,可惜irst9.x系列兼容性受到了限制,只能割爱。
经网上收集,imsm5.5对早期的ICH5R出现部分不兼容现象,最高只能用到5.0,考虑到体积问题,iaar4.7的选择无疑更佳。
对于ICH8、9 AHCI(也就是Crack的),只有用imsm7.x的最合适,从实践上来看无疑imsm7.8最为合适。
***其实从兼容性的角度出发,无论如何imsm7.5~7.8都必需采用其中一个,其他版本并不见得能驱动2824和2923这两个hwid。

[ 本帖最后由 netwinxp 于 2010-4-14 20:32 编辑 ]
回复

使用道具 举报

715#
发表于 2010-4-14 20:42:17 | 只看该作者
我知道netwinxp 验证的方案好,上面那个是其他人做的,想让你修改下,然后使用,让我自己修改整不来呀。
回复

使用道具 举报

716#
 楼主| 发表于 2010-4-14 20:47:02 | 只看该作者

回复 #728 freesoft00 的帖子

我得先把emulex和mv91xx搞定了,才好推出对应的F6方案,txtmode搞定后肯定会推出对应的F6方案,不过体积可能会有点大。
回复

使用道具 举报

717#
发表于 2010-4-14 20:52:29 | 只看该作者
mv91xx直接打包为 zip ,用srs的那个模块加载到
虚拟软驱,提供f6安装不行吗?
回复

使用道具 举报

718#
发表于 2010-4-14 20:57:22 | 只看该作者
原帖由 netwinxp 于 2010-4-14 20:47 发表
我得先把emulex和mv91xx搞定了,才好推出对应的F6方案,txtmode搞定后肯定会推出对应的F6方案,不过体积可能会有点大。


我把服务器和板卡都剔除之后,少了6M多,还不包括你后面的补丁,实际估计得7M,现在整个drivers压缩后大概是5M

我觉得是不是把服务器和板卡,以及一些可能冲突的型号移到F6,只留pc和笔记本部分在内核,这样的pe驱动比较合理呢

当然,如果f6是用于xp安装,那就得考虑另外的方案了
回复

使用道具 举报

719#
发表于 2010-4-14 21:05:45 | 只看该作者
我的静等,体积超过1.44无所谓,只要常用的pc、笔记本就差不多了。逆天使的那个就挺精简的。
除了出f6方案,希望也出一个可以用nlite或者RVM_Integrator整合到xp安装盘里面的包,f6方案整理完了,这个样的整合包估计也改不了什么,上面的那个是nlite的包,下面这个是RVM_Integrator的整合sata的包
http://u.115.com/file/f123c7a62c
回复

使用道具 举报

720#
发表于 2010-4-14 21:12:59 | 只看该作者
我最后也可能提供一个更精简的内核驱动,可能只有intel,amd,nv
等,另外,如果不支持声卡什么的,应该可以控制在3M

我有外置srs可以解决其它驱动问题。

xp安装盘,现在没必要集成驱动了,因为实际安装,可以通过pe下安装,
这样驱动问题就可以轻易解决了。光盘安装也一样,只是方式不同。

我也收集了网友的两个工具,并更新了之前的f6.img以配合使用。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|Archiver|捐助支持|无忧启动 ( 闽ICP备05002490号-1 )

闽公网安备 35020302032614号

GMT+8, 2024-11-16 11:12

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表